#bde0c0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#bde0c0 is composed of 74.1% red, 87.8%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 14.3%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 125.1 degrees, a saturation of 36.1% and a lightness of 81%. #bde0c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#7bc181.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#bde0c0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f2f9f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#bde0c0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#ccd1cc is the less saturated color, while #9ffea7 is the most saturated one.
